Forest fire area in Gelendzhik grows to 30 hectares – Kommersant
[ad_1]
The forest fire area in Gelendzhik has increased to 30 hectares, more than 400 people and 70 pieces of equipment are involved in extinguishing it. Two Mi-8 helicopters were also involved, reported Ministry of Emergency Situations.
There were no casualties. According to the agency, the extinguishing is complicated by strong winds with gusts of up to 30 m/s and rugged terrain. The Ministry of Emergency Situations clarified that there is no threat to infrastructure facilities.
The fire started yesterday, August 29, in the Kupriyanov Shchel microdistrict on Rechnaya Street. Initially, the fire area was estimated at 1.5 hectares, later it spread to the territory of Bobrukovo Shchel. Administration of Gelendzhik asked residents with equipment and fire extinguishers to help extinguish the fire. A suspect was arrested for setting fire to dry grass.
